5, Laburnum House Coatham Road, Redcar, TS10 1TA is a leasehold flat built in 2007 onwards. The property offers approximately 672 square feet of living space and is situated on the 1st floor of a 4-storey building. In this location, apartments of similar size usually have two b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£124,117 , which equates to approximately £186 per square foot. It was last sold on 15 Dec 2006 for £125,000. Since then, the value has decreased by £883, representing a 0.7% decrease, or approximately 0.0% per year.

The current estimated value of £124,117 is:

  • 5.5% higher than the average property price on Coatham Road
  • 59.5% higher than the average in the TS10 1TA postcode area
  • and 31.9% lower than the average price for Redcar as a whole

At the most recent EPC inspection on 25 January 2011, the property was recorded as owner-occupied.

5, Laburnum House Coatham Road, Redcar, Redcar And Cleveland, TS10 1TA has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of C, based on the latest assessment carried out on 25 Jan 2011.

This property uses electric storage heaters as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from off-peak electric immersion heater.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 17 Aug 2009. The rating of C remains the same, but the energy efficiency score improved by 6.8%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The hot water energy efficiency improving from poor to average, while the system remained as electric immersion, off-peak.
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in 9% of fixed outlets to low energy lighting in 15% of fixed outlets, with efficiency improving from very poor to poor.
